About the Company

The Reader’s Digest Association, Inc., is a global multi-brand media and marketing company that educates, entertains and connects audiences around the world. With offices in 44 countries, it markets books, magazines, and educational, music and video products that reach a customer base of 100 million households in 78 countries. It publishes 94 magazines, including 50 editions of Reader’s Digest, the world’s largest-circulation magazine, operates 65 branded websites generating 22 million unique visitors per month, and sells approximately 68 million books, music and video products across the world each year. Its global headquarters are in Pleasantville, N.Y.
